Biggest tip - bring a lot of money! :) If you have a car you will be happier going out to eat because the selections onsite are expensive and not too child friendly, well, to my family anyways! The pool is shaded for much of the day, which is nice. It's a huge place so make sure you learn the way around so you can get where you are going quicker.

We had cars so we self-parked (my DH will not pay to valet) so I don't know about the transportation. It is closest to Pop century and ESPN sports area, but it isn't far to Disney parks at all.

osceola parkway toll road will need change, I don't know how much.

have fun, explore the whole place, get some bocce balls from the stand by the pool and play! We did the mini-golf as well, and my son had fun.
 
If you can, try Villa de Flora. This is their amazing buffet. And don't forget to look for the gators in the atrium.
